On Route 20
Weston is the eastern on-route anchor in the tenth live Massachusetts stretch, carrying Route 20 toward the Boston-side suburbs without forcing a full inner-metro coverage.
Why stop here
Weston matters when you want the Massachusetts side of Route 20 to feel meaningfully farther east than Marlborough while still holding a compact public edge.
What kind of stop it is
Best described as an eastern anchor, compact edge, or stronger stretch stop.
Time-to-spend guidance
Most travelers should treat Weston as a moderate stop or anchor point for the stretch, especially when using nearby Framingham as a practical base.
What it pairs with
Weston pairs most naturally with Wayland and Sudbury as the on-route continuity towns to the west, and with Framingham when you want a bigger adjacent support city for lodging or logistics.
